USU Football’s Justin Rice Named Mountain West Defensive Player of the Week

USU Football’s Justin Rice Named Mountain West Defensive Player of the Week

LOGAN, Utah-Monday, Utah State football graduate senior inside linebacker Justin Rice earned Mountain West Defensive Player of the Week honors for the second consecutive week. Rice posted an interception, a forced fumble, a career high-tying 14 tackles and two tackles for a loss in the Aggies’ 49-45 win over Air […]

Juvenile justice reforms allow demolition of youth lockup

Juvenile justice reforms allow demolition of youth lockup

SOUTH SALT LAKE, Utah (AP) — Demolition crews have begun work tearing down a former long-term, secure lockup facility for child offenders. The executive director of Utah’s Division of Juvenile Justice Services tells Fox13 that’s because juvenile justice reforms are allowing dollars to be reinvested in serving youth in their […]
